[QUOTE="WildRose, post: 2424049, member: 30902"] Well if it were me I'd just take those reamer specs and call whomever made the reamer and have them make me a set of dies to match. Probably send them some once fired brass to ensure they get it right. I'm probably going to do a .30 next myself and I'm having a hard time deciding whether to do a PRC or maybe do some sort of improved version using the same .375 Ruger case. I've gotten to where I shoot the .375's so much I probably have four hundred rounds of once fired brass just setting in a bucket so I'm going to do several WC's using it as the parent case this year. I'll definitely do a 7mm, and probably a .338 while I decide on exactly what to do for the .30 cal project. I hate to say it but I'll probably use a coupe of my M70 300wm's as donors for the project since I'm not shooting them all that much anymore. [/QUOTE]
